Output d3a327294606e46d2fac15945ce77243bcd2107db675e8caf10a5102371982e6:2

value
10012730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26d3bbac7a5944698e5bcb41c30f2c2f2a75c584 OP_EQUAL
address
MBSTZCB7uwJjh58rJguu72vzGaiviYDxct
transaction
d3a327294606e46d2fac15945ce77243bcd2107db675e8caf10a5102371982e6
spent
true